Sri Ganesha Sankat Nashana Stotra For Sankashti Chathurthi
In every month of the lunar calendar, two Chaturthis are observed. One that is seen after Amavasya is known as Ganesh Chaturthi. The other one comes in the Krishna Paksha after the Poornima day. This Chaturthi is known as the Sankashti Chaturthi.
Sankashti fasting is done every month by the Hindus and is considered to be very auspicious. When the Sankashti Chaturthi falls on a Tuesday, it is known as Angarki Chaturthi. This day is considered to be very auspicious. Fasts and Poojas are done on this day. Sankashti Chaturthi is celebrated in the south and western regions of India. The states of Maharashtra and Tamil Nadu celebrate this occasion with special enthusiasm.

The people keep fasts for Lord Ganesha. They consume only fruits, vegetables and roots on this day. The fast is broken only after one sees the moon at night. It is believed that Lord Ganesha destroys all the obstacles in the lives of his devotees and blesses those that observe the Sankashti Chaturthi fast.
On this occasion, we present to you the Sri Ganesh Sankat Nashana Stotra. It is one of the most powerful stotras dedicated to Lord Ganesha. Read on to learn the Stotra and its meaning.
Sri Ganesha Sankat Nashana Stotra & Its Meaning
"Om
Pranamya
Sirasa
devam
Gauri
Puthram
Vinayakam
Bhaktavasam
Smarennithyam
Ayuh
Kamartha
Siddaye"
With head bowed, let me unceasingly worship in my mind the god Vinayaka, the son of Gauri, the refuge of his devotees, for the complete attainment of longevity, amorous desires and wealth.
"Prathamam
Vakrathundam
cha
Ekadantham
Dvithiyakam
Thrithiyam
Krishna
Pingaaksham
Gajavakthram
Chathurthakam"
Firstly, as the one with the twisted trunk. Secondly, as the one with the single tusk. Thirdly, as the one with the fawn coloured eyes. Fourthly, as the one with the elephant's mouth...
"Lambodaram
Panchamam
cha
Shashtam
Vikatameva
cha
Saptamam
Vighna
Rajam
cha
Dhoomravarnam
thathashtakam"
Fifthly, as the pot-bellied one, sixthly, as the monstrous one, seventhly, as the king of obstacles, eighthly, as the smoke coloured one...

"Navamam
Phala
Chandram
cha
Dasamam
thu
Vinayakam
Ekadasam
Ganapathim
Dwadasam
thu
Gajananam"
Ninethly, as the moon crested one, tenthly, as the remover of hindrances, eleventhly, as the Lord of the hordes, twelfthly, as the one with the elephant's face.
"Dwadasaithani
Namaani
Thri
Sandhyam
Yah
Pathennarah
Na
cha
Vighna
Bhayam
thasya
Sarva
Siddhi
karim
Prabho"
Whosoever repeats these twelve names at dawn, noon and sunset, for him there is no fear of failure, and there is constant good fortune.
"Vidyarthi
Labhate
Vidyam
Dhanarthi
Labhate
Dhanam
Puthrarthi
Labhate
Putraam
Mokshaarthi
Labhate
Gatim"
He who desires knowledge obtains knowledge. He who desires sons gets sons. He who desires salvation obtains the way.
"Japeth
Ganapthi
Stotram
Shadbhirmaasai
Phalam
Labheth,
Samvatsarena
Siddhim
cha
Labhate
Naathra
Samsayaha"
Whosoever mutters the hymn to Ganapati reaches his aim in six months, and in a year reaches perfection, on this point there is no doubt.
"Ashtabhyo
Brahmanebhyash
cha
Likhitwa
yah
Samarpayeth
Thasya
Vidya
bhavetsarva
Ganeshasya
Prasadathaha"
Whosoever makes eight copies of it, and has them distributed to as many brahmans, he reaches knowledge instantaneously, by the grace of Ganesh.
"Ithi Sri Narada Purane Sankata Nashana Ganapathi Sthothram Sampoornam."
